#ISA31 Council debates scope of #deepseamining regulations: should they apply to all mineral resources in the Area or only polymetallic nodules? Some favor the latter option while others support a general framework, with resource-specific details to follow in standards & guidelines. #oceangovernance
How are liabilities from #deepseamining addressed if contractors lack sufficient financial resources?
At #ISA31, Council discussed a proposed solution to ensure financially capable parent companies take responsibility for environmental harm and risks

At #ISA31, Council members debated whether unannounced inspections of #deepseamining operations should be allowed.
Many supported retaining this possibility to monitor compliance with the regulations, while others cautioned they could be difficult to implement

At #ISA31, Council members consider including a profit share on transfers of rights under #deepseamining contracts. Many support the idea, noting significant capital gains may arise from such transfers & the #ISA should share in benefits from the #seabed which is the common heritage of humankind.
#ISA31 Council members discuss the regulation on an "equalization measure," which aims to ensure #deepseamining contractors pay a similar effective tax rate to land-based mining regardless of tax exemptions provided by sponsoring states. #oceangovernance #mining
